The Kolkata Knight Riders vs Mumbai Indians Timeline (MI vs KKR) rivalry is one of the most thrilling and historic matchups in Indian Premier League (IPL) history. From explosive batting displays to nerve-wracking finishes, every clash has delivered unforgettable cricketing moments. Since their first meeting in 2008-when Sanath Jayasuriya’s 48* off 17 balls powered MI to a 7-wicket win at Eden Gardens-this rivalry has been filled with high drama, strategic battles, and individual brilliance.
MI, the five-time IPL champions, boast a strong home record at Wankhede Stadium (10-2 vs KKR) and lead the overall head-to-head 24-11 in 35 encounters. However, KKR’s resurgence in 2024, including their IPL title triumph, has added extra spice to this classic matchup. Fans still recall Rohit Sharma’s masterful 79* in 2023 at Wankhede while chasing 192, or Sunil Narine’s reinvention as an opener in 2024, where his 27-ball 64 helped KKR secure a playoff berth in a rain-shortened Eden Gardens clash.

MI’s pace trio -Jasprit Bumrah, Trent Boult, and Rahul Chahar – consistently uses the bounce and pace-friendly conditions at Wankhede to trouble opposition batters. Their ability to strike early and maintain pressure in the death overs has made Mumbai’s home ground a fortress, turning matches in their favor time and again.
On the other hand, KKR’s spin duo – Sunil Narine and Varun Chakravarthy – has often dominated in Kolkata, where the pitch assists slower bowlers. Their clever variations and tight lines have repeatedly restricted Mumbai’s strong batting order. These tactical battles between pace and spin continue to define every thrilling MI vs KKR encounter in the IPL.
Latest Matches Between MI and KKR

Below is a detailed overview of the last 8 T20 encounters between the two sides:
| Tournament | Venue | Date | Toss | MI Score | KKR Score | Result | Player of the Match |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| IPL 2025 Match 12 | Wankhede, Mumbai | Mar 31, 2025 | MI (Bowl) | 121/2 (12.5 ov) | 116 (16.2 ov) | MI won by 8 wkts | Ashwani Kumar (MI) – 4/24 |
| IPL 2024 Match 51 | Wankhede, Mumbai | May 3, 2024 | KKR (Bat) | 145 (18.5 ov) | 169 (19.5 ov) | KKR won by 24 runs | Venkatesh Iyer (KKR) – 70 & 1/17 |
| IPL 2024 Match 60 | Eden Gardens, Kolkata | May 11, 2024 | KKR (Bat) | 139/8 (16 ov) | 157/7 (16 ov) | KKR won by 18 runs | Varun Chakravarthy (KKR) – 2/17 |
| IPL 2023 Match 22 | Wankhede, Mumbai | Apr 16, 2023 | MI (Bat) | 192/5 (20 ov) | 185/6 (20 ov) | MI won by 5 wkts | Ishan Kishan (MI) – 81 |
| IPL 2022 Match 14 | DY Patil, Navi Mumbai | Apr 6, 2022 | KKR (Bowl) | 161/4 (20 ov) | 168/5 (20 ov) | KKR won by 5 wkts | Pat Cummins (KKR) – 56* |
| IPL 2021 Match 5 | MA Chidambaram, Chennai | Apr 13, 2021 | KKR (Bowl) | 152 (20 ov) | 142/7 (20 ov) | MI won by 10 runs | Rahul Chahar (MI) – 4/27 |
| IPL 2020 Match 35 | Abu Dhabi | Oct 16, 2020 | KKR (Bat) | 149/2 (16.5 ov) | 148/5 (20 ov) | MI won by 8 wkts | Quinton de Kock (MI) – 78* |
| IPL 2019 Match 25 | Eden Gardens, Kolkata | Apr 25, 2019 | KKR (Bat) | 108 (14.1 ov) | 175/3 (20 ov) | KKR won by 67 runs | Andre Russell (KKR) – 80* & 1/15 |
